Cyber Threats Are Rising for UK Dental Practices
Cybercrime is no longer confined to large corporations—dental practices are increasingly at risk. According to the BBC, recent cyber-attacks targeting UK organisations demonstrate the growing sophistication of cybercriminals, often employing ransomware to lock businesses out of critical systems and demand payment.
For dental clinics, this could mean losing access to patient records, appointment bookings, and financial data, causing severe disruption and reputational damage. Cybersecurity is no longer a convenience; it is a necessity for any clinic relying on digital patient management software.
